Molded Pulp Packaging Market Overview

The Molded Pulp Packaging Market was valued at USD 4.55 Billion in 2025 and total revenue is expected to grow at a CAGR of 4.5% from 2026 to 2034, reaching nearly USD 6.77 Billion by 2034, according to Maximize Market Research. Molded pulp, also known as molded fiber packaging, is produced from recycled wood and non-wood materials such as paper sheets, newsprint and other fiber sources.

MMR identifies sustainability as the central demand theme. Molded fiber can protect products during transportation while offering an alternative to conventional plastic and foam formats. Growing use across food service, dairy, electronics, healthcare and manufacturing is widening the addressable opportunity for fiber-based packaging.

Key Growth Drivers Fueling the Molded Pulp Packaging Market

Demand for sustainable packaging: MMR expects growth to be supported by rising demand for environmentally responsible packaging from food service, dairy, electronics, healthcare and manufacturing users. Greater focus on reducing plastic waste is encouraging brands to evaluate fiber-based alternatives.

Growth in packaged food consumption: Rising disposable income and greater consumption of packaged foods and food-service products support demand for protective fiber formats.

Recycled-material advantages: Molded pulp is produced largely from recycled paper pulp, giving it strong positioning in circular packaging strategies.

Technology and product innovation: MMR expects manufacturing inventions and technology advances to support business development. Improved molding, structural design and barrier solutions are broadening applications.

E-commerce and protective packaging needs: The cushioning properties of molded fiber make it relevant for electronics and fragile products moving through distribution networks.

Market Segmentation  By Source, Molded Type, Product & End Use

  • Source: Wood Pulp over 86% share of sales in 2025; Non-wood Pulp. MMR expects non-wood pulp to grow at the fastest rate over the forecast period.
  • Molded Type: Thick Wall; Transfer Molded expected to account for the largest share in value and volume; Thermoformed Fiber; Processed Pulp.
  • Product: Food; Trays  over 41% of total revenue in 2025; Clamshells; Cups; Plates; Bowls; Others.
  • End Use: Food Service Disposables; Food Packaging; Healthcare; Electronics; Others. MMR highlights strong demand from food and beverage applications and growing use in healthcare and electronics.

The Molded Pulp Packaging Market is therefore anchored by wood pulp and trays, while transfer-molded technology leads by expected value and volume. Wood pulp benefits from lower cost and broad availability, while trays gain from convenience, shock absorption and stability in food applications.

China

China receives the strongest country-specific regional discussion. MMR states that China's food and beverage industry accounted for the largest share of the Asia-Pacific regional market, while environmental concerns have encouraged stricter recycling policies, restrictions on single-use plastics and adoption of biodegradable packaging.

Recent Developments & Strategic Moves

  • Amcor collaborated with Metsä Group in May 2025 to develop three-dimensional molded fiber packaging combined with high-barrier film liners, expanding fiber alternatives for perishable-food applications.
  • Stora Enso entered a strategic partnership with Matrix Pack in June 2025 and acquired a minority stake to accelerate formed-fiber packaging innovation and replacement of single-use plastics.
  • Huhtamaki completed its acquisition of Zellwin Farms Company in May 2025, expanding molded-pulp manufacturing capacity in North America. Huhtamaki has also deployed robotics and artificial intelligence for quality control on a smooth-molded-fiber production line, demonstrating investment in automated fiber manufacturing.
  • PulPac introduced a new generation of Dry Molded Fiber caps and closures in March 2026, targeting recyclable, bio-based alternatives for bottle systems.
  • Regulatory momentum is increasing as the European Union's Packaging and Packaging Waste Regulation establishes requirements covering packaging design, composition, recoverability and waste prevention, strengthening incentives for circular packaging materials.

AI & Digital Transformation Impact on Molded Pulp Packaging Market

How is AI changing the Molded Pulp Packaging Market? AI is increasingly supporting manufacturing quality control, process consistency and automation rather than changing the fiber material itself. Huhtamaki has described a fiber-lid production line using robotics and artificial intelligence to inspect finished products, illustrating how smart manufacturing can improve repeatability and quality assurance.

Digital manufacturing can also use real-time machine data, preventive maintenance and automated material flows to improve operating efficiency. These capabilities support scalable production as packaging manufacturers pursue higher output and more consistent fiber products.
